/** * Gets a reader for an IMember's Javadoc comment content from the source attachment. * and renders the tags in HTML. * Returns <code>null</code> if the member does not contain a Javadoc comment or if no source is available. * * @param member the member to get the Javadoc of. * @param allowInherited for methods with no (Javadoc) comment, the comment of the overridden * class is returned if <code>allowInherited</code> is <code>true</code> * @param useAttachedJavadoc if <code>true</code> Javadoc will be extracted from attached Javadoc * if there's no source * @return a reader for the Javadoc comment content in HTML or <code>null</code> if the member * does not contain a Javadoc comment or if no source is available * @throws JavaModelException is thrown when the elements Javadoc can not be accessed * @since 3.2 */ public static Reader getHTMLContentReader(IMember member, boolean allowInherited, boolean useAttachedJavadoc) throws JavaModelException { Reader contentReader= internalGetContentReader(member); if (contentReader != null) return new JavaDoc2HTMLTextReader(contentReader); if (useAttachedJavadoc && member.getOpenable().getBuffer() == null) { // only if no source available String s= member.getAttachedJavadoc(null); if (s != null) return new StringReader(s); } if (allowInherited && (member.getElementType() == IJavaElement.METHOD)) return findDocInHierarchy((IMethod) member, true, useAttachedJavadoc); return null; }
